The Clover Valley – Pop Tart Protein, Carbohydrates, Fats, Vitamins and Nutrient Values

Clover Valley – Pop Tart is a Clover Valley type of food with 1 tart serving size that provides 200 calories. Clover Valley – Pop Tart has 74% carbohydrate, and 22% fat, 4% protein in 100 gram of Clover Valley – Pop Tart. Clover Valley – Pop Tart nutrient values are 37 g carbohydrate, 2 g protein, and 5 g fat. Clover Valley – Pop Tart has the vitamins A, and C within it. Clover Valley – Pop Tart has 10 % vitamin A and 0 % vitamin C. Clover Valley – Pop Tart has 190 mg sodium, 0 mg potassium, 0 mg cholesterol, and 0 g trans fat. Clover Valley – Pop Tart has 1 g dietary fiber, and 17 g sugar. 1 serving of Clover Valley – Pop Tart provides 10 % iron, 0 g polyunsaturated and 0 g unsaturated fat along with 2 g saturated fat.
